4. Rotated means "turned around on an axis or
a central point."
A robot is programmed to do the jobs that
a person usually does.
Reversed means "moved in the opposite
direction.
Something that is defective has a flaw or
weakness.
5. A meteor is a piece of rock from space.
Something that is dangling is hanging or
swinging loosely.
Someone who staggered would be said to
have swayed or walked unsteadily.
Tokens are pieces that mark your place on
a game board.
6. Reading Who Says Robots Can't Think? (p. 358)
Analogies
Analogies compare
two pairs of words.
Sometimes analogies
use synonyms, words
that have similar
meanings. For
example broken is to
defective as tidy is to
neat.
